About The Role

InHealth is the leading provider of diagnostic and screening services in the UK, serving over 4 million patients annually with a mission to increase this to 5 million by 2025. We are at an exciting stage of growth, and our commitment to excellence and innovation in healthcare has never been stronger. With a dedicated team of over 3,500 colleagues across 850 locations, we are focused on improving patient outcomes and enhancing staff well-being.

We are seeking a dynamic and experienced leader to join us as the Director of Clinical Quality. Reporting directly to the Chief Medical Officer (CMO), you will play a pivotal role in shaping and overseeing our clinical governance framework. Your leadership will ensure that we maintain the highest standards of patient safety, quality, and compliance as we continue to expand our services.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Lead and enhance clinical governance across the organization to drive continuous improvement in patient safety and service quality.
  • Collaborate with the CMO to develop and implement quality assurance strategies that align with national regulatory standards.
  • Provide expert leadership in areas such as PSIRF, safeguarding, infection prevention, and independent investigations.
  • Foster a culture of excellence, professional development, and teamwork across all staffing groups.
  • Represent InHealth at national and international levels, building partnerships and promoting best practices.
  • Oversee the production of high-quality reports, including monthly governance updates for the Board and Executive Team.
  • Ensure robust risk management processes are in place and integrated into operational and financial planning.

About You:

  • Registered nurse or healthcare professional with current registration.
  • Master's degree or equivalent experience in healthcare leadership.
  • Extensive experience in clinical governance, quality improvement, and healthcare regulation.
  • Proven ability to lead and inspire teams, drive change, and manage complex healthcare environments.
  • Strong communication and interpersonal skills, with experience in presenting complex issues to diverse audiences.
  • Passionate about improving patient care and outcomes, with a commitment to maintaining high-quality standards.

About Us

InHealth is the UK's largest specialist provider of diagnostic and healthcare solutions. Our aim is to make healthcare better for patients by working collaboratively with the NHS to deliver a range of high-quality tests, scans, assessments and procedures. In the last year, we have supported more than 4 million people in their healthcare journeys, the majority of these are NHS patients and service users.

As a people-focused organisation, our teams are integral in how we deliver our services and our values of Trust, Passion, Care and Fresh Thinking underpin everything we do, influencing the way we interact with patients, customers, and colleagues.

Our mission is to be the preferred provider of high-quality diagnostics and healthcare solutions in hospitals and in accessible community settings, serving 5 million patients from 1,000 locations by 2025.
